    Are you searching for a meaningful and enriching summer experience for your child? The Visiting Nurse Association (VNA) of Texas is offering a unique one-day camp opportunity this summer for children ages 8 to 11 — and it’s more than just fun and games. The Meals on Wheels Kids Camp, hosted by VNA, is designed to educate and inspire the next generation of volunteers and philanthropists.

    The drought is over. Delicious central Texas-style barbecue has returned to West Lovers Lane and a part of the Park Cities/Bluffview/Devonshire that’s been without it for far too long. Ten50 BBQ opened its doors to the public today at 5519 West Lovers Lane. The restaurant, which first debuted in Richardson in 2014, is known for its dedication to traditional “low and slow” techniques and its no-shortcuts approach to quality meat and scratch-made sides.

    The best little Farmers Market in town opens for the season Saturday, April 26. This is the 14th year the Saint Michael’s Farmers Market has taken place on church grounds located at Saint Michael and All Angels Episcopal Church at 4344 Colgate Ave. and Douglas Avenue in University Park. The market was created in 2012 by The Reverend Bob Dannals and the late Guy Griffeth as a way to build community and provide fresh, locally grown and produced food to the community.

    Spring is in the air, on the 49th floor of The National in fact, since Monarch restaurant introduced its new Spring Tasting Menu. Created and brilliantly prepared by Executive Chef Jason Rohan, the tasting menu is replete with spring’s greenest gems; English peas, asparagus, ramps, and watercress set alongside fresh seafood and local Wagyu. On a crystal clear evening in early April, I experienced Monarch’s new six-course spring tasting menu with wine pairings.

    Good things come to those who wait, the saying goes. That’s good news for the throngs of us who missed proximity to great barbecue after Sonny Bryan’s closed its Lover’s Lane location in May 2022. Almost three years to the day, a second location of the award-winning Ten 50 BBQ will open in that same spot. Ten50 BBQ’s new store is slated to open in early May and will serve craft barbecue and classic sides all made on the premises.
